
Meaning: The name Guadalupe holds varied meanings depending on cultural or personal interpretations. Based on our research, one commonly accepted meaning is River of Black Stones.
Origin and Linguistic Roots: The name Guadalupe likely originated from Spain, where it has its linguistic and ethnic roots.
Gender Association: Our findings suggest that Guadalupe is most commonly used as a gender-neutral name.
Popularity: According to data from the U.S. Social Security Administration (SSA), which publishes annual rankings of baby names, Guadalupe is currently not listed among the top 1,000 names for girls and Guadalupe is currently not listed among the top 1,000 names for boys.
